Fan Section (code EFA-FD/FR)
The EFA-FD/FR fan section is a unit section with
built-in fan with vertical outlet for use as a supply air
or extract air fan in ventilation systems together with
other functional sections in the Flexomix series.
Design
• EFA-FD with direct-driven fan (code ELFD).
The direct-driven fan is supplied with any of the
following types of motor:
- Motor including mounted frequency inverter.
- Motor to efficiency class eff1, for connection
to an external frequency inverter.
- Motor to efficiency class eff2, for connection
to an external frequency inverter.
• EFA-FR with belt-driven fan (code ELFR).
The belt-driven fan is available in two versions:
- ELFR-FB belt-driven centrifugal fan with,
casing, forward-curved blades.
- ELFR-BB belt-driven centrifugal fan with,
casing, backward-curved blades (sizes 150-950).
• To facilitate servicing, the fan and motor unit are
withdrawable from the casing.
• To adequately cool the motor, the air tempera-
ture should not exceed 50 ˚C.
• The fan and motor are very effectively vibration-
isolated from the casing with a vibration attenu-
ated outlet spigot and rubber mountings sized
to suit the fan's operating conditions.
Normal resonance frequency is 7–10 Hz.
• The standard outlet of the fan section is
equipped with an end connection.
• The design of some of the components in the
fan system do not conform to corrosion resist-
ance class C4.
